April 6, 2004 – Individuals intending to sell food at this year's V.I. Carnival festivities are reminded that they must obtain a permit from the Health Department's Environmental Health Division.
The food-handler permits are required for food vendors planning to work at Lionel Roberts Stadium, the Food Fair, the Village, the boat races, J'ouvert, the Children's and Adult Parades and the horse races at Clinton E. Phipps Race Track, according to a Government House release issued on Tuesday.
